In this episode, I discuss how to give and receive constructive feedback effectively, especially in technical and trades environments. I share practical examples, personal mentoring stories, and tips for resourcefulness and trust-building in feedback processes.

key topics
- The importance of specific, relevant, and actionable feedback
- How to handle vague or unhelpful feedback from managers
- The role of trusted technical allies in learning
- Strategies for resourcefulness when feedback is unreliable
- The impact of feedback on apprentices' growth and confidence
